Where is the cabin air filter located in the Chery A3?
2 Answers
The cabin air filter in the Chery A3 is located beneath the front windshield, covered by a black plastic cover. The cabin air filter provides fresh air to the passenger compartment, preventing occupants from inhaling harmful gases and ensuring driving safety. After prolonged use, the activated carbon filtration function of the cabin air filter will diminish, so it should be replaced promptly. The air conditioning filter of the Chery A3 is located under the rain trough cover panel right below the front windshield, which can be seen after opening the hood. I've driven this car for several years and find it quite convenient to replace it myself every time. Just remove that plastic cover panel—usually by prying open the clips with your hands or a screwdriver—and the filter will be exposed. Remember to replace it regularly, about once a year or every 10,000 kilometers, otherwise dust and odors will accumulate inside the car, which is particularly bad for breathing.
